Balsamic Pork Chops

Here's how you make Balsamic Pork Chops
Pause Continue Reading
  • Servings: 2
  • Prep: 5m
  • Cook: 15m
  • The following recipe serves 2 people.

Ingredients

The ingredients are:
  • 2 pork (6 ounces each) chops (trimmed of fat, bone-in or boneless your choice)
  • 1/2 teaspoon lemon-pepper seasoning
  • 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 1/4 cup low-sodium chicken broth (fat-free)

How to Make

  • Step 1: Spray a nonstick skillet with cooking spray and heat over medium-high heat.

  • Step 2: Sprinkle both sides of each pork chop with lemon-pepper seasoning; add to pan and cook 3 minutes on each side to brown.

  • Step 3: Remove chops from skillet and keep warm; wipe drippings from skillet with paper towel and return to stove over medium-high heat.

  • Step 4: Combine vinegar and broth in skillet; bring to a boil, then cook,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ened, about 5 minutes.

  • Step 5: Return chops to skillet (discard any drippings that remain on plate) and turn to coat; cook an additional 2 minutes on each side (or until done). Serve chops drizzled with sauce that remains in pan after they are removed to plates.
